Following the end of campaigns in Ondo State, ahead of today’s governorship elections, Bayelsa State Governor, Hon. Henry Seriake Dickson, on Friday called on stakeholders and critical actors in the process to ensure that, nothing is done to undermine peace, security and stability.
He also called on INEC and security agencies, particularly to act, in a non-partisan manner according to their constitutional mandate, to provide a level playing field for the conduct of peaceful polls.
The governor also warned against “any temptation to engage in acts capable of undermining the security and stability of Ondo State in a desperate attempt to deliver any pre-determined outcomes.”
Dickson added that such untoward action could have far reaching negative consequences, beyond Ondo State.
He emphasised that “we should be guided by history.”
